About the role
Hexwired Recruitment is working with a globally recognised research and development company specialising in advanced audio technology, currently seeking to fill a Senior Embedded Linux Engineer job in Geneva to join its growing engineering team in Geneva, Switzerland.
Due to continued expansion and increasing demand from an international customer base, the company is looking for an experienced embedded software professional with strong Linux Kernel development expertise and a passion for high-performance audio systems. This is an excellent opportunity to work on innovative products used worldwide while contributing to cutting-edge developments in audio technology.
The RoleAs a Senior Embedded Linux Engineer, you will play a key role in the design, development, and optimisation of embedded software for next-generation audio products. The position requires a high degree of technical independence, with the successful candidate expected to take ownership of complex projects while also collaborating with multidisciplinary engineering teams.
Working on advanced audio and streaming technologies, you will help develop robust, high-performance solutions used across a range of commercial and professional applications. This role offers exposure to challenging engineering problems and the opportunity to work with world-class specialists in a highly innovative environment.
Located in Geneva, the position also offers access to one of Europe’s most desirable locations, with some of the world’s leading ski resorts within easy reach.
Key Responsibilities- Design, develop, and maintain embedded Linux software for advanced audio products.
- Contribute to Linux Kernel development and low-level system optimisation.
- Work on high-performance embedded platforms supporting audio processing and streaming technologies.
- Take ownership of software development projects from concept through to implementation and support.
- Collaborate with hardware and software engineering teams to deliver reliable and scalable solutions.
- Support system integration, testing, debugging, and performance optimisation activities.
- Contribute to the development of innovative products for a global customer base.
- Work independently on technical challenges while supporting wider project objectives.
The ideal candidate will have extensive experience developing embedded Linux systems within audio, video, broadcast, or related technology sectors.
Essential requirements include:
- Master’s degree or PhD in Embedded Systems, Electronics, Audio Engineering, Mathematics, or a related technical discipline.
- More than 10 years of commercial experience developing Embedded Linux solutions.
- Strong expertise in Linux Kernel development and low-level software engineering.
- Previous experience working within the Audio, Video, Broadcast, Entertainment, or Media Technology industries.
- Interest in audio technology, audio streaming, or video streaming systems.
- Ability to work independently and manage complex technical projects.
- Strong problem-solving skills and a proactive engineering mindset.
- Excellent communication and collaboration abilities.
